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.1; en-US; rv:1.9.1.4) Gecko/20091017 SeaMonkey/2.0 Works for me. However, after loading the page, I got a popup (although I have popups blocked). The title bar said "The page at http://servscanner03.com says:" The content said "Warning!!! Your personal computer needs to install antivirus software. Antivir can perform fast and free virus and malicious software scan of your computer." When I selected the Cancel button, some kind of scan started anyway. I killed it. I then searched for any new .exe or .dll files, but I found none. I have AVG installed. Although I just updated AVG a few days ago, I'm updating it again. I will then scan my whole PC. In the meantime, I added http://servscanner03.com to my Adblock Plus filter. -- David E.
